"Modern Age Pharaohs" by Sherwin Long

Property of SJLart
medium: Acrylic on wood 
size: 12"x17.75"
This painting is a representation of the modern age of man where technology is the making everybody complacent and apathetic. Slowly we are losing our grip on humility and demanding more and more resources. In the search for knowledge have we lost touch with the purpose of our existence and how to coincide with the natural world. As we move forward I wonder if this progression is going to be as beneficial as we are promised. we must remain hopeful and keep seeking the truth. I enjoyed making this painting on the wood surface because it gave a nice texture to the background and to the gold as well. I work with light washes of paint so that it allows the wood grain to stay visible.  As I keep experimenting with new materials I am finding new ways to articulate myself. I am enjoying this journey and hope that along the way I inspire others to embrace innovation and remain passionate as we venture forth.
